Signs Your Pipes May Need Relining

If you’re not certain whether or not your pipes need relining, here’s some signs to look for:

  • Water leakage
  • Odors coming from your drains
  • The sound of gurgling is coming from your drains
  • Clogs or slow drainage

Should I Have My Pipes Relined or Replaced?

This is a concern that many homeowners have to have to ask at some point. Both replacement and relining have their pros and cons and it can be tough to decide which is the best choice for you. Here are a few concerns to take into consideration:

Relining

  • Relining is much less expensive than replacement.
  • It’s possible without tearing up the floor or walls.
  • It can be done quickly and usually within one or two days.
  • There’s less mess to take care of after the job is finished.
  • The new liner is expected to last for many years.

Replacement

  • Replacement is more expensive than replacing.
  • It can be a messy job as well, and you may need to leave your home for a couple of days during the time it’s being done.
  • The new pipe should last for many years.

The Pipe Relining Method

In the past in the past, to repair a pipe, you had to dig. It was tedious, lengthy and costly operation.

Today, thanks to pipe relining also known as trenchless pipe lining , or trenchless sewer repair, it is possible to get rid of all of this. Simply saidpipe relining The Patch is the process of embedding new pipes in older ones.

The days of digging into the yard, pounding, and disintegrating your house’s foundation are long gone. If your pipe is leaking, you are able to line it by relining it. The pipe can be lined to ensure that it’s structurally sound.

We offer the following simple, messfree process:

  • We Investigate
  • We Clear
  • We Reline
  • We Cure & Cut
  • We Clean

Can You Reline Pipes That Have Bends In Them?

Yes trenchless pipe relining is an excellent, no-dig method to repair broken pipes with bends within their pipe. The process of pipe relining creates an entirely new pipe within the pipe that is already in place. This means that you won’t have to tear out the old pipe and can replace it without digging up your yard or driveway.

The difficulties of a pipe-relining project is increased with the number of bends within the pipe. Our experts have repaired many sewer line pipes with bends in them.

Although this can be challenging, it is not impossible and we’ve got the knowledge and the know-how to get this job done right.

Will Sliplining Stop Roots From Trees Getting Into Drainage System?

Yes, trenchless pipe relining solutions could help in stopping tree roots from getting into your sewer. Sliplining is the process of creating a new pipe within the old one, and helps close any openings, cracks or holes that could allow roots to get into.

In addition, regular maintenance and cleaning of your drainage system can assist in stopping tree roots from getting into them.

What’s the Difference Between Pipe Relining And Pipe Replacement?

Pipe relining is the job process of creating a new pipe inside the old one, while pipe replacement causes the pipe to break and replaces it by a new one.

Pipe relining tends to be less invasive and is a more cost-effective alternative to pipe replacement. Consult a professional regarding your particular requirements to determine which option will work best for you.

Will Pipe Relining Affect The Pipe Flow?

There is typically no reduction in pipe flow in the event of the relining of pipes. Relining pipes can increase the amount of flow that flows through the pipe since it creates a smooth, new surface for water to travel through.

How Long Has Pipe Relining Been Used?

Pipe relining was used for many years, with the first documented case dating back to 1854. However, it wasn’t until the beginning of the 2000’s when it started to be used more frequently.

Nowadays, pipe relining technology is utilised all over the world as an efficient method to fix leaks or damaged pipes, without the need to remove them and replace them completely. There are many different types of pipe relining solutions which can be utilised according to the type of pipe used and the severity in the extent of damage.

For instance, there’s spot pipe relining The Patch, which is used for small leaks as well as structural pipe relining which is used for more severe damage. Whatever kind of pipe relining is used, the purpose is the same: repair the pipe without replacing the entire pipe.

This alternative that does not require excavation could help you save time and money, and it is also a more eco-friendly option than relocating the pipe.
